He Walked Through the Fields

  (1967)
Hu Halach B'Sadot
In 1946, young Uri (Assi Dayan) returns from college to his much-changed kibbutz, where he falls for a newly arrived Polish refugee named Mika (Iris Yotvat). But with Israeli statehood approaching, Uri knows he'll soon be conscripted into the army -- and forced into a dilemma. Set during the dramatic days of the birth of Israel, this affecting drama is based on Israeli author Moshe Shamir's acclaimed novel.
Cast: Assi Dayan, Iris Yotvat
Director: Yosef Millo
